Chris Dickie
Director of BioNB

Chris Dickie holds a Bachelor of Science in Forestry from the University of New Brunswick and launched his career as a forestry contractor and consultant, managing operations and forest plans in Ontario and New Brunswick. In 2004, he joined INFOR Inc., serving 40,000+ private woodlot owners and Christmas tree producers.

Over the next decade, Chris collaborated with various stakeholders on programs and research projects. In 2014, he joined the New Brunswick Department of Agriculture, Aquaculture, and Fisheries, contributing to the 2016 economic development plan.

In 2018, Chris co-founded 1812 Hemp, focusing on CBD production. He also worked as a consultant, assisting companies in establishing operations in New Brunswick. In 2020, he embarked on constructing a multi- million-dollar COVID-19 test production facility.

In 2023, Chris became the Director of BioNB at ResearchNB, leveraging over a decade of experience in the bioeconomy sector.

Candice Pollack
Director, External Affairs

Candice Ashley Pollack is the Director, External Affairs with ResearchNB. Candice enjoys tackling complex challenges and believes that there is always a way to move the needle forward. With her education and background in law, as well as years of professional experience leading health and social systems improvement initiatives, she brings creativity, resourcefulness, critical thinking, and drive to every role she takes on.

 

Candice is also deeply passionate about public policy and human rights’ discourses. She has contributed to published works on youth participation rights, children’s rights in a globalized economy, and knowledge translation for policy decision-making.

 

Candice values the various communities she is a part of and has been actively volunteering with local and national non-profits for over 15 years. Currently, Candice is the Public Member of the New Brunswick Association of Social Workers’ Board of Directors, the Past-Chair of the Canadian Bar Association’s Young Lawyers Section, and the Second Vice-Chair of the Heart & Stroke Foundation of New Brunswick.
